Sunnah Table Manners


Narrated 'Umar bin Abi Salama: “I was a boy under the care of Allah's Apostle and my hand used to go around the dish while I was eating. So Allah's Apostle said to me, 'O boy! Mention the Name of Allah and eat with your right hand, and eat of the dish what is nearer to you." Since then I have applied those instructions when eating.” 
288 Sahih Bukhari.

Food is a big blessing of ALLAH, and Our Beloved Prophet Muhammad S.A.W taught us the manners and ways to handle it. These were his ways and we should follow them. The top Hadith tells us to start with the name of ALLAH, and then eat what’s in front of us first instead of eating from different sides of the plate. There is another thing we do is that we criticize the food that ALLAH blessed us with, if we don’t like that food we should just keep quiet and leave it, instead of being ungrateful and say what doesn’t please ALLAH (May ALLAH forgive us if we are ungrateful …AMEEN). And we should always say ALHUMDULILLAH because there are people out there dying from hunger.

“The Prophet (PBUH) never criticized any food (he was invited to) but he used to eat it if he liked the food, and leave it if he disliked it.”
- Sahih Bukhari
